Michelle Malkin: Impeach pro-illegal immigration judges

Outspoken illegal immigration opponent and author Michelle Malkin is stepping up her war on sanctuary states and federal judges opposed to President Trump’s crackdown at the border.
In a small gathering in Boston to address the issue after a larger venue canceled her appearance, Malkin called for the impeachment of pro-illegal immigration judges and warned against the spreading sanctuary movement that is led by California.
Malkin, in the session hosted by the group SafeBoston, was interviewed by Center for Immigration Studies Policy Director Jessica Vaughan and asked about court decisions against the president.
She labeled the judges “sanctuary anarchists," adding, “These are every bit as damaging anarchists in our society, the ones that issue these local injunctions in their small jurisdictions and then blow it out nationwide."
In a just-posted video of the event, she said, “I don’t mean this glibly, but I really think that there should be some sort of impeachment movement of these judges, right? Never mind the impeachmentpalooza on Capitol Hill."
Malkin is on a book tour to promote her latest, Open Borders Inc.: Who's Funding America's Destruction?
Several of the Trump administration's efforts to curb immigration and asylum, limit those coming in from countries suspected of promoting terrorism, adding a citizenship question on the Census, and enforce long-ignored federal immigration laws have been blocked by some federal judges.

She also ripped the explosion of sanctuary areas approved by state and local governments that bar cooperation with Immigration and Customs Enforcement officials seeking to arrest criminal illegals, including those wanted for rape and murder.
Malkin, who has been holding “Stand With ICE” rallies in sanctuary cities, described how many areas where she’s lived have become sanctuary areas.
“I went from L.A., sanctuary; Seattle, sanctuary; Montgomery County, Maryland, sanctuary. I go to Colorado thinking, OK, this will be a great place to raise my kids in Colorado Springs, the home of Focus on the Family. And what’s happening there now? We’ve got a governor who’s trying to – well, he’s playing both sides, but ultimately what they’re trying to do is county by county, you know, Californicate the whole entire country,” she said.
